I mailed the driver contact at Intel with a link to this page and to
their bugzilla link I gave above, just saying that a lot of people had
problems and were keen to contribute to a fix if we could.
I got a mail back saying:-
"A community member recently backported a fix for RX overrruns in the ipw2200 driver. I assume the same problem may exist in the ipw2100
driver. If you are interested you can try to backport the fix to the ipw2100 driver ... details are here:
http://marc.info/?l=linux-wireless&m=120302948521611&w=2
"
This is beyond my skills but might be useful to someone?
